How We Evaluated These Mattresses
Our top picks are based on the ones that scored the best in each performance category. We will continue to update the list as mattress models are re-tested and new models come out.
- Motion Isolation: Motion isolation refers to how well a mattress suffocates movement and blocks it from moving across the surface. Mattresses that have thicker comfort layers are more likely to block the motion of people who are often disturbed by their partner’s movement.
- Temperature Control: A temperature-controlled mattress should ensure the sleeper is not too hot or cold. Mattresses that are made of breathable materials like cotton, wool, latex, and coils are great at regulating temperature.
- Pressure Relief:A pressure-relieving mattress is designed to contour the body in order to lessen the buildup of pressure in joints. Most mattresses are made of more dense comfort layers of memory foam that slowly adapt in the form of the human body.
- Off-Gassing:Mattresses in a box or made of synthetic materials are more prone to odors that emanate from off-gassing. These odors are due to VOC (VOC) emissions. These are generally harmless but can be a nuisance.
- Ease of Movement:Mattresses that perform well in this category usually have responsive surfaces that allow sleepers to move about the bed without any restrictions. Combination sleepers have a mattress that scores excellent marks for ease of movement.
- Edge Support:Edge support refers to a mattress’ weight-bearing capacities along its perimeter. A mattress that has supportive edges allows sleepers to lie further away from the edges of their bed, thereby increasing the bed’s overall usability.
- Sex:Many sleepers use their mattresses not just for sleeping, but also for sex. Mattresses that score high in ease of movement, edge support and temperature control also tend to be successful in this area.
- Body Weight:Body weight is one of the factors you need to consider when deciding on your ideal firmness level. Your sleeping position and preferences are equally important, which is why we suggest trying several models to determine the most comfortable feel.

What are the most comfortable mattresses for side sleepers?
The majority of people who sleep on their side prefer memory foam, mattress, or hybrid. Sleepers who sleep on their sides are more susceptible to developing pressure points at their shoulders and hips which can make it difficult to sleep or trigger next-day discomfort and pain.
Mattresses with a higher than average pressure relief softly contour against the pressure points that could be created regardless of the mattress’s firmness overall giving side sleepers the comfort and support they require. Although not all foam and foam hybrid mattresses are pressure-relieving enough for sleepers on the side They tend to perform significantly better in this area as opposed to innerspring or latex mattresses.
What are the best mattresses to help back {pain|discomfort?
There are features that people with back pain tend to all appreciate. These include cushioning for the lumbar region, zones of support that are ergonomically designed, and sturdy edge support. Sleepers who have shoulder or upper back pain must also think about the features that ease pressure mattresses before purchasing one since inadequate pressure relief could cause tension in these areas.
The ideal mattress for back discomfort is one that promotes proper spinal alignment and gives great support for your body type and preferred sleeping position. While some specific mattresses are popular with people suffering from back pain, the ideal mattress for one person could leave another feeling worse the following day.
What are the best mattresses for those who sleep hot?
People who sleep very warm should consider purchasing an innerspring or latex mattress. Mattresses made of innersprings without foam comfort layers provide the greatest temperature stability due to their excellent airflow and latex is temperature neutral and stays much cooler during the night than synthetic foams.
Latex hybrids can be cooler because pocketed coils allow airflow exactly like an innerspring. If you prefer the feel of synthetic foams such as memory foam -choose a foam hybrid with temperature-regulating features. These are warmer as an innerspring and latex mattress, yet offer better temperature control than an all-foam mattress.
